43 Reeves Mews, London, W1K 2EH is a freehold terraced property built in 2007 onwards. The property offers approximately 6,641 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have six b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£23,565,789 , which equates to approximately £3,548 per square foot. It was last sold on 28 Aug 2015 for £22,500,000. Since then, the value has increased by £1,065,789, representing a 4.7% increase, or approximately 0.5% per year.

The current estimated value of £23,565,789 is:

  • 744.3% higher than the average property price on Reeves Mews
  • 62.4% higher than the average in the W1K 2EH postcode area
  • and 2,592.4% higher than the average price for London as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 19 July 2013,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

43 Reeves Mews, London, City Of Westminster, Greater London Authority, W1K 2EH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of B, based on the latest assessment carried out on 19 Jul 2013.

This property uses a gas boiler with underfloor heating as its main heating source. It is connected to mains gas.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 30 Apr 2010, when the property was rated E. Since then, the rating has improved to B,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 60.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from boiler and radiators, mains gas to boiler and underfloor heating, mains gas, changing energy efficiency from very good to good.
  • The hot water energy efficiency changing from very good to good, while the system remained as from main system.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 150 mm loft insulation to pitched, insulated (assumed), with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, as built, insulated (assumed), improving energy efficiency from very poor to good.
  • The windows were upgraded from single glazed to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 20%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to very good.
